Delhi: 3 teenagers drown while bathing in Munak canal near Rohini

New Delhi: An official said that three teenagers were died while bathing in the Munak canal near the Haiderpur water treatment plant in Rohini area of Delhi. The deceased teenagers had gone to the Monak canal for a bath.

According to the police,a Police Control Room call received a distressed call at KNK Marg police station regarding the drowning of the three boys. A passerby informed the police about the drowning incident around 3 pm on Wednesday.

After receiving information about this incident, local police, along with the fire brigade and teams from the Delhi Disaster Management Authority (DDMA) rushed to the spot. Despite rescue efforts, the boys remained unresponsive and were later declared dead on arrival at Dr BSA Hospital in Rohini.

Initial investigation revealed that the victims were minors and residents of Bhalswa Dairy. The three had entered the canal to take a bath, leading to their death. Police said that the bodies were preserved in the mortuary for the post-mortem examination. Officials have launched further investigation into the circumstances of the incident.
